Candace Owens and Turning Point USA became embroiled in a public dispute after Owens questioned the authenticity and context of a viral Charlie Kirk video. Owens claimed the organization ignored her private email seeking clarification, while TPUSA responded publicly, insisting the video was real and accusing her of being a “freak.” Screenshots of Owens’ alleged email were also shared online, further escalating tensions. The controversy has since sparked intense debate across conservative media circles and social media platforms.

Candace Owens and Turning Point USA are now locked in a very public feud after a social media exchange over an alleged video involving Charlie Kirk escalated overnight. What started as a private request for confirmation quickly turned into an apparent clash between two influential conservative voices, drawing attention across online political media circles. Tensions grew after Owens publicly questioned Turning Point USA’s handling of its inquiry about a circulating video linked to an event in Wisconsin. She claimed the organization ignored her email while continuing to publicly address the issue on X. The controversy has since fueled speculation among followers who are closely monitoring the relationship between Owens and the conservative youth organization she has frequently worked alongside.

Turning Point USA strikes back as online discord escalates

The organization addressed Owens directly while also posting screenshots of an email she allegedly sent seeking clarification on several questions related to the video.

“Hey @RealCandaceO, the video is real (as you apparently learned 7 months ago)! Charlie wasn’t kidding. Your obsession is unstoppable!” I hope this takes care of setting up your presentation for the next couple of days. Welcome back to the greatest country on the planet.

Note: These are 3 questions, comrade. Forward🇺🇸” A screenshot was attached to the post showing what appeared to be an email from Owens asking if the video was real, if Charlie Kirk was joking, and if donors associated with the event were involved in raising fears.

Candace Owens wonders what the turning point is in the USA Video by Charlie Kirk

Owens first addressed the issue directly in a post targeting Turning Point USA CEO Andrew Colvitt. Her letter raised concerns about whether the organization was officially behind previous allegations posted on social media.

“Hey @AndrewKolvet – is this an official statement from Turning Point? I know you once blamed a young employee for using this account and not expressing your official positions.I would just like to hear from you that the video has not been manipulated in any way because you are in your official capacity to confirm this and for some reason you just did not answer my email.Thank you in advance!”The post quickly gained traction, garnering thousands of interactions within hours.

Owens appears to be focusing on one central issue: whether the video circulating online is authentic and presented in its proper context. The exchange is now larger than the original video itself. Supporters on both sides are debating not only the authenticity of the footage, but also the increasingly tense relationship between prominent conservative media figures.
